Kaylyn F. Mabey

Kaylyn Fergus Mabey manages the Research Library for the Willamette Heritage Center in Salem, OR.  An avid genealogist and researcher, she has authored several books on her own family history and is a regular contributor to the Statesman Journal, Willamette Heritage Center blog and other local publications.
